The Ethics of Pension Funds: Investors Making Change
Beyond GDP: The Social Progress Podcast
23 minutes
1 day ago
The Ethics of Pension Funds: Investors Making Change
In this episode, we challenge the foundational purpose of modern business, asking a provocative question: Is your hard-earned pension money funding the very companies that undermine your long-term health and the stability of the planet?
